Recreating Your Wardrobe

March 22, 2015 by Katie Haller

With it being the beginning of a new season, it’s the perfect time to head out to the stores and stock up on some new spring looks.  Well, if you’re trying to save money, you might want to rethink that idea.  For me, I’ve definitely been feeling the urge to go shopping lately.  I have a new job and the weather keeps getting warmer and warmer.  I’d love to go drop a bunch of money on a new wardrobe, but I can’t do that on my budget.  One thing that I have always found helpful to keep me out of the stores when I get that itch to go shopping, is to reinventing my wardrobe.  It’s time for me to get creative and take a deeper look at my clothes to find new ways to wear them. 

 One way I’ve been recreating my wardrobe lately is by taking a second look at older pairs of jeans.   I have too many pairs of jeans to count, yet I always feel like I need a new pair.  This is probably because I don’t wear all of them.  I still have jeans that I wore in college sitting in my closet.  Instead of buying new jeans, I’ve been trying to wear my old ones, but just style them a little differently by rolling them. 
Here are a couple examples. 
I’ve had these American Eagle jeans for a while.  I bought them at TJ Maxx for a really great price about 6 years ago.  They have escaped my clothes donation bag a few times, mostly because they’re my only pair of ripped jeans.  I’m not really feeling the flared jean look as much anymore, so instead of getting rid of them and shopping for a new pair of ripped jeans, I decided to style them a little differently by rolling them and making them look more tapered.  Now I have a cute casual pair of jeans to wear. 
Give your jeans a new look by rolling the bottom
These jeans are from Express.  I bought them on clearance a few years ago.  I really haven’t gotten a whole lot of use out of them until now.  They are cute straight-legged jeans, but they’re a little long on me.  So I’ve been just rolling them a bit.  They have been a great pair of jeans to wear during the week to work.

Another way that I have been reinventing my wardrobe, is by mixing my winter clothes with my summer clothes.  I really like the look of mixing my winter tops with shorts and dresses.

Here are a few examples. 

Navy blazer with shorts
I wore my navy blazer (Target) with a striped navy tank top (Target), light khaki shorts (Old Navy) and white sandals (Target). 
Black sundress with red boyfriend cardigan and leopard scarf
For this look, I wore a black sundress (Target) with a red boyfriend cardigan (Target).  I accessorized with a lightweight leopard scarf (Charming Charlie) and leopard flip flops (Express). 
LC Lauren Conrad black blouse with shorts and wedge sandals
This look is great for a warm summer night.  I wore a black LC Lauren Conrad blouse (Kohl’s) with my khaki shorts (Old Navy) and my wedged sandals (Kohl’s)
If you’re bored with your clothes, the best advice I can give to you is to accessorize them up!  Accessorizing can take a simple outfit you wear all the time and turn it into something brand new.
 
Accessorizing a simple black sundress
Here is a great example of what accessories can do for an outfit.  This is one of my favorite black sun dresses.  I bought it at Express when I was in college, so it’s been in my closet for awhile.  I usually wear it in the summer with a simple necklace and some flip flops.  I decided to try it out with my coral necklace and wedged sandals.  Now I have a great new look perfect for a summer night or even a tropical vacation. 
Striped dress
I bought this dress last spring at Target.  It’s super cute on its own, but when I accessorize it with my green bead necklace, silver belt, black cardigan and wedge shoes, I have a new outfit!  It’s perfect for work, church or even a shower luncheon. 

It really doesn’t take much to make your old clothes feel like new again.  You just have to get creative.  Before you do your spring shopping this year, look in your closet first and try something new.  You never know what you will find!

Shopping Finds- Searching for a Bathing Suit on a Budget

March 7, 2015 by Katie Haller

It may not feel like it for most of the country, but summer is right around the corner.  With this in mind, I’ve been searching for the perfect bathing suit.  I’ve been in desperate need of a new bathing suit for a while now.  Since I don’t have a body like a Victoria Secret model, bathing suit shopping has never been fun for me.  Yet I still love a great swimsuit.  If you can find something that flatters your body, you’ll feel great! 
Now that I’m 30, not 21, I wanted to find a 2 piece that would be flattering and age-appropriate.  I also wanted to find something affordable.  Usually, I’d wait until late summer when bathing suits get marked down, but with 80-degree weather in the forecast for next week, I couldn’t hold off that long. 
Before I buy anything, I always go right to Pinterest to get an idea of what I want.  Here are a few of my favorite bathing suit pins.
Top Left: Victoria Secret Top Right: Victoria Secret Bottom Left: Revolve Bottom Right: Anthropologie

As you can see, I love a black bathing suit.  Black is classic and flattering, plus it goes with everything.  I like that I can mix and match my black tops and bottoms with other bathing suit tops and bottoms that I have in my drawers.  This way I don’t only get 1 new bathing suit, I get 3 new bathing suits.  I also wanted a bottom that would cover my backside and acute top that also had decent coverage.

If money was no object, I’d probably buy all 4 of these bathing suits above, but since I can’t really afford to buy even one of them, I had to look around for a suit in my price range.  I always try to stick to a $30 budget for all my clothes, including my bathing suits.

I ended up finding a cute bathing suit last weekend at Target.  They had a buy one get one 50% off sale going on.  Target bathing suits usually run between $12.99-$24.99 per piece.  Because of the sale, I was able to stick to my $30 budget.

Settling into a New Life

March 7, 2015 by Katie Haller


It’s been a while since my last post.  I don’t like going that long in between posts, but I’m sure you all understand that my life has been a little busy this past month.  So here’s a catch-up!

Kevin and I are settling very nicely into our new life here in Nevada.  When I last posted, I was living out of my suitcase, stuck in the rainy northwest, waiting for my new life to start.  A lot has changed since then!  

I was fortunate enough to get a new job right away.  This was the first job I applied to, the first and only one I interviewed for, and luckily it was my first choice.  I’m back in a classroom teaching preschool.  I couldn’t be happier about that!  It was a bit stressful at first starting my new job because I started working only a few days after we returned from Washington, leaving us very little time to get our lives together here.  We needed to find 2 cars and a place to live and we only had a week to do it.  We learned that Vegas is different than Michigan, and we were going to have to re-evaluate the way we live our lives on a budget.  In Michigan, we had it down. We lived in an older apartment with cheap rent, in a nice safe community.  We drove older used cars with no car payments and cheap car insurance.  Once we started our search here in Las Vegas, we quickly learned that we would have to change our ways in order to save money in the long run.  The apartments were not what we were looking for and were overpriced.  The used cars were junk and Craigslist took us to some pretty shady parts of town. 

After 2 days of being extremely let down with our findings, we had to seriously re-think our plan, or at least Kevin did, I just supported him.  We ended up getting pretty lucky.  After a fire alarm at the, oh so lovely airport hotel we were staying at, (I could not wait to get out of that place) woke us up at 3 in the morning, Kevin did some major searching online for places to live.  He ended up finding the perfect condo for us, in a great area, right in our price range.  We ended up getting the place and moving in only a few days later.  (The landlord was extremely impressed with Kevin’s great credit.) As for our cars, we ended up doing something we never thought we would do.  We went to the Ford dealership and leased 2 of the cheapest, most practical cars they had.  Now we have monthly car payments, but after our horrible car repairs back in Michigan, (we were way to close of friends with our local mechanic) it’s worth it to have the peace of mind of a full factory warranty on our vehicles.  

In no way is moving cheap.  It’s the most money that we have ever spent all at once, besides paying off my student loans.  The thing is that we wouldn’t have been able to do this entire move without our saving these past few years.  We lived small, spent small and saved big.  Now we are finally getting to feel the benefits of our savings. I’m grateful to be married to an over-planner.  

I have to say that our move has had it’s ups and downs, but in the end it’s been a great experience.  It definitely has brought Kevin and I closer together and made us a stronger couple.
